S&P: Several Argentina companies to negative
Standard & Poor's said it revised to negative from stable the outlooks and affirmed the ratings on several Argentine companies.
Those companies include Aeropuertos Argentina 2000 SA, Alto Palermo SA, Clisa-Compania Latinoamericana de Infraestructura & Servicios SA, IRSA Inversiones y Representaciones SA, Transportadora de Gas del Sur SA, Alto Parana SA, Loma Negra CIASA and Petrobras Argentina SA.
The agency also said it affirmed the ratings on its Capex SA, Compania de Transporte de Energia Electrica en Alta Tension Transener SA, Electricidad Argentina SA, Empresa Distribuidora Y Comercializadora Norte SA, Hidroelectrica Piedra del Aguila SA, Industrias Metalurgicas Pescarmona SAIC yF, Mastellone Hermanos SA and Raghsa SA.
The actions follow the outlook revision on the Republic of Argentina to negative from stable.
The outlook revision reflects a belief that a potential downgrade of the sovereign would lead to a similar action on these companies, S&P said.
This is mainly because of their asset and cash-flow concentration in Argentina and absence of insulating factors that might help these companies to continue honor their financial obligations under a sovereign default scenario, the agency said.
